2005 Cadillac Deville Introduction
  For more than 50 years, the DeVille has been one of the most popular models sold by Cadillac. The current model was last redesigned in 2000. Traditional in its styling, it features an egg crate grille and vestiges of tailfins in its vertical LED-equipped taillights. By most accounts, the DeVille is a sophisticated American luxury car that remains true to Cadillac's heritage. Between its powerful engine, cavernous interior and multitude of high-tech vehicle systems, the DeVille offers a little bit of everything. There's more than enough room for four adults and the trunk can swallow a weekend's worth of baggage with room to spare. Compared to other cars in its price range, the interior could use some higher-quality materials, but overall it's a clean design with simple controls.

2005 Cadillac Deville Body Styles, Trim Levels and Options
The DeVille is available in three models: the base DeVille, a ritzy DeVille High Luxury Sedan (DHS) and a sporty five-passenger DeVille Touring Sedan (DTS). Designed to provide an affordable entry point to DeVille ownership, the base model offers tri-zone automatic climate control, leather upholstery, power front seats and one-touch windows.

In terms of luxury features, the DHS is the one to get, as it nets you heated and cooled front seats, seat memory for the driver, a heated rear bench, lumbar adjustment for outboard rear passengers, a power rear sunshade, rain-sensing wipers, a Bose sound system and audio controls mounted on a wood-trimmed steering wheel. The performance-oriented DTS features a continuously variable road-sensing suspension (CVRSS) that monitors and adjusts individual shock damping according to road surface changes for maximum comfort and performance. Popular stand-alone options on the DeVille include a DVD-based navigation system and six-disc CD changer. XM Satellite Radio is also available.
